Abstract

Ozonation of adamantane adsorbed on silica gel produces visible chemilummescence in the wavelength range of 400-650 nm. When the supply of O3 stops, chemiluminescence decays in a first order reaction with the effective rate constant k. Its dependence on the initial amount of adamantane and temperature has been studied.
